+20090318:
+  AFFECTS: users of www/suphp
+  AUTHOR: yzlin@cs.nctu.edu.tw
+
+  The suPHP port has been upgraded to 0.7.x. This new version of suPHP has
+  some new features and changes for the configuration file:
+
+    - Multiple path (with patterns) & variable substitution support for
+      docroots
+    - Double-quoted strings at section '[handlers]'
+      ex. application/x-httpd-php="php:/usr/local/bin/php-cgi"
+
+  These changes may lead to internal server error if without modifications
+  of the configuration file from previous version.
